MattyB DEPT looking for perfection in Perth

Photo in Canberra Times 14th April 2010 by Melissa Adams

In the final meet for the domestic season 5 MattyB DEPT athletes will look to finish off a season close to perfection for the squad.

Sprint queen Melissa Breen along with 400m Hurdle pair Lauren Boden and Brendan Cole come into this meet with Commonwealth Games ‘A’ qualifiers and with victory at nationals will lock in an automatic spot for the Commonwealth Games later in the year.

Joining them will be the recently crowned Stawell Gift winner Tom Burbidge who will run in the 400m (possibly 200m) in what will be a great experience for him against the best 1 lap runners in the country. With a personal best of 48.28 Tom will be looking to put a big dent in that in Perth.

Tarin Nevin will join her hurdle partners and will be looking to again make it through to the national final. Tarin is fresh from her latest victory which saw her take out the NSW State Championships in a season best.

Actions starts on Friday.
